1.去官網(wǎng)下載Charles?https://www.charlesproxy.com/
2.安裝MacOs證書
a.打開Charles點(diǎn)擊help找到 SSL Proxying 然后 選擇 Install Charles Root Certificate 把證書安裝到電腦窗慎,具體如下圖
安裝Mac證書
b.打開鑰匙串找到Charles Proxy 證書 并且設(shè)置信任
信任證書
2.安裝iPhone設(shè)備證書
a.打開Charles 選擇help 然后選擇SSL Proxying 選擇 Install Charles Root Certificate on aMobile... 然后根據(jù)提示 在瀏覽器輸入對應(yīng)IP(或者直接在瀏覽器輸入 chls.pro/ssl )
安裝手機(jī)證書
輸入IP安裝設(shè)備證書
b.去設(shè)備信任剛下載的描述文件掸冤,并且 去“證書信任設(shè)置”開啟Charles證書信任開關(guān)
信任描述文件
開啟證書信任
3.打開Charles 選擇Proxy
SSL 設(shè)置
設(shè)置需要攔截的域名逻族,或者全部攔截
4.數(shù)據(jù)抓取成功